Output 2c18f69ca0a507d85ad8c6dbb9ab4690e42c5fbce5c934e8015e21b58a225acb:1

value
6602860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ac4d0fea185ee3623702367872cde5608a7bdec OP_EQUAL
address
39xxWrHxhaq8VWqH1BuVDWna2VsbNjEmje
transaction
2c18f69ca0a507d85ad8c6dbb9ab4690e42c5fbce5c934e8015e21b58a225acb
confirmations
351323
spent
true